Description

Patented Aug. 28, 1945 OFFICE ABRASIVE PAPER ROLLS Hugo Mock, New York, N. Y.
No Drawing. Application January 10, 1945,
Serial No. 572,253
2 Claims.
This invention relates to abrasive papers in roll form, and more particularly to abrasive papers intended not for the usual grinding or abrasive purposes, but for cleaning pots and pans used for cooking.
A particular object of this invention is the provision of an improved paper roll which with the addition of small amounts of water can be used to remove the dirt and grease remaining in cooking pots and pans and which will require a minimum of labor and material for that purpose.
As the base of my improved paper roll I provide an absorbent paper tissue in roll form, such as is commonly used for toilet and cleansing tissue, but of very thick material, and on one side of the roll I provide a thin layer of wax, such as paraffin wax, which is prominently attached to the roll, but does not penetrate to the interior thereof, the wax penetrating to the paper merely sufficiently to be permanently adherent thereto. On the surface of the wax there is then applied an abrasive powder which is made in the following manner:
I use as the base of this powder infusorial or siliceous earth of marked abrasive properties and this powder is sprinkled with a solution of a caustic alkali such as sodium hydroxide or with a solution of sodium carbonate to impart some.
alkaline properties to the same. After the particles of abrasive are coated with the alkaline liquid, the material is thoroughly dried and after drying is dusted on, or otherwise applied to, the wax surface of the paper roll. For convenience in use, the paper may be scored at intervals and a protective layer of tissue paper maybe applied to the abrasive layer, if desired. In using it is sufiicient to moisten the bottom of the cooking pot desired to be cleaned and then to rub the same thoroughly with the abrasive side of the paper, giving the alkali in the abrasive time to work on the fats or greases present. After this, the soft side of the roll containing the absorbent tissue is applied .to mop up the material in the pot or pan and the paper roll is applied for this purpose until a clean surface is presented.
Having fully described my invention, what I claim is:
1. A new article of manufacture useful in cleaning pots and pans comprising a sheet of absorbent paper adapted to be put up in roll form, a thin layer of wax applied superficially to one surface only of said paper, and an abrasive in powdered form applied to said thin wax layer, the abrasive side of the paper being adapted to be rubbed on a dirty surface to be cleaned and the abrasive-free, absorbent surface being adapted to clean up the dirt dislodged by the abrasive.
2. A new article of manufacture useful in cleaning pots and pans comprising a sheet of absorbent paper adapted to be put up in roll form, a thin layer of wax applied superficially to one surface only of said paper, and an alkalicarrying abrasive in powdered form applied to said thin wax layer, the abrasive side of the paper being adapted to be rubbed on a dirty surface to be cleaned and the abrasive-free, absorbent surface being adapted to clean up the dirt dislodged by the abrasive.
